OREGON LEAGUE KICKS OFF 2010 SEASON WITH EIGHT TEAMS
The Oregon Football League is one of the oldest operating minor leagues in the Northwest. The Portland Monarchs won the league championship this past season with an undefeated season, then went on to capture the championship of the Great Northwest Conference Bowl, with a win over the Wenatchee Valley Rams, Champions of the Washington Football League.
Here is the lineup of teams for 2010:
Springfield Buzzards, Roque Warriors, Portland Monarchs, Klamath County Crusaders, Umpqua Valley Knights, High Desert Lightning, Oregon (Eugene) Outlaws and the Washington based Vancouver Vipers.

AMERICAN INDOOR FOOTBALL ASSOCIATION ADDS TWO WASHINGTON TEAMS FOR 2010
Baltimore, Maryland-The American Indoor Football Association added two new expansion franchises for 2010. The Yakima Valley Warriors, which will play its home games in the 6,000 seat SunDome Arena, and the Wenatchee Valley Venom, which will play at a new arena in tow.
The Wenatchee Valley Venom is coached by Keith Evans, a former RB in the Northwest Football League, and former Head Coach with the Alaska Wild of the Indoor Football League. Web site: wenatcheevalleyvenom.com
Other western teams in the AIFA are the New Mexico Wildfire, Odgen(Utah) Knights, and Wyoming Calvary, the defending AIFL Champions.
AIFA ANNOUNCES THE SAN JOSE WOLVES FOR 2010
San Jose, California-The San Jose Wolves are the latest Western team to be added to the lineup of new teams for 2010 by the American Indoor Football Association.
The San Jose Predators were a dominate member of Arena 1, winning several league championships. When the league folded, the Predators folded with them. The Wolves have a new ownership team.

COPPER LEAGUE OF ARIZONA ANNOUNCES LINEUP OF TEAMS FOR 2010 WINTER SEASON
Phoenix, Arizona-The Copper Football League will kick off a new season in January 2010 minus two of its top teams. The two time defending champion Tri City Titans, and the Tucson Blaze are not listed as members. Word has it the two teams have formed a new league along with some other teams in Arizona. Returning teams:
Arizona Thunder, East Valley Mustangs, Glendale Bulldogs, Glendale Rangers, Globe-Miami Sting, Northern Arizona Coyotes, Phoenix Outlaws and Tempe Rams.
Missing our the Tri Cities Titans, 2009 Champions, and Tucson Blaze.
